How Dangerous Is Myocardial infarction From DULAGLUTIDE?

Of the 288 reports, 38 (13.2%) resulted in death, 136 (47.2%) required hospitalization, and 15 (5.2%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Myocardial infarction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for DULAGLUTIDE. However, 288 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
